The gang flew through the sky following Karukono. Gohan's 'condition' weighed heavily on everyone's minds. Goku was lost in thought when something made him stop. Everyone else halted to see what was wrong.
"Chichi..." Goku muttered. He then sped off in the opposite direction.
"Piccolo what is he doing?" Videl asked.
Piccolo spaced out as if he was searching for something in his head.
"Gohan. He couldn't have..." Piccolo trailed off.
"What's going on tell me?!" Videl pleaded.
"It looks like we are going to have to take a detour. Vegeta make sure Karukono doesn't stray off." Piccolo ordered.
"I do not take orders from a Namek. I'll watch her but on my own account. NOT because you said to." Vegeta commented.
Piccolo started after Goku and the others followed. Videl struggled desperately to keep up with everyone. They touched ground in front of an iced disaster. Videl landed last and found everyone huddled in the living room. She peeked around from behind Piccolo. Her eyes grew wide.
"Gohan didn't do this!" She blurted.
Everyone turned to her, their eyes stern and serious. Goku had the look of insanity in his eyes. Videl hesitated for a moment.
"Gohan would never hurt his family...he couldn't..." Videl said lowering her head.
"You've forgotten already! I told you he isn't the same Gohan you knew. He is a killer." Karukono reminded her.
Karukono's words hit everyone hard. Goku looked back at his frozen wife and son with sadness, fear, and anger. He rose to his feet and turned to his friends.
"We can't look at him as Gohan. He may have the same face...but our Gohan is gone. We have to take him down." Goku decided.
A tear dropped from Videl's eyes. Karukono noticed and she stared into Videl with a hint of hurt in her eyes. Karukono felt a strange urge to embrace Videl, to comfort her...but she refrained and turned away.
"Shall we continue?" Karukono said, breaking the silence. Goku nodded, and one by one, they filed out of the murder scene and back into the air.
A city stood in ruins. Blood covered the buildings and not a sound could be heard. Dead bodies littered the torn streets. Gohan stood in the very center of the city. His eyes glowed red with power. His hands tensed and muscles ached. He stared angrily at the ground in front of him. His head started to pound. At first it was a dull pain, but it grew sharper and sharper until to forced him to his knees. Gohan put his hands against his head in a futile attempt to stop the pain. His muscles started to pulsate. His vision went out of focus. His hand turned to fists and smashed into the ground breaking the concrete. He gasped for air. Gohan raised his head towards the grey sky. His eyes were black, normal, but they were wide with great fear. He stood up and stepped backwards, his eyes new to the horrible site before him. Gohan hit his back against a wall and sank to the ground. He stared at his bloody hands.
"What's wrong with me...why is this happening..."
Hs eyes raced back and forth as he tried to remember all that had happened. He saw everything he had done. The murder of countless innocents...his mother...Goten... He gagged and his head fell forward as he fainted.
Videl felt a pang in the back of her head. Her eyes narrowed.
"Gohan..." she mumbled under her breath.
Karukono lead them to a dead, lifeless, sandy desert. She searched around for small crater. Karukono landed next to the crater and leaned over it to look inside. The others followed and stood behind her.
"This is it." Karukono stated as she proceeded to jump down into the crater.
Goku followed her, then Vegeta, Videl, and last Piccolo. The room was dark save for a few flickering lights. The horrible smell of rotting flesh lingered in the air. Their senses cringed as the tasted the stale air. They followed Karukono to the portal against the wall. Videl gave a small yelp when her foot grazed the professors' dead body. Karukono touched the surface of the portal and it sprang to life with a soft glowing green color. Karukono sighed.
"Ready?" She asked.
They nodded and Karukono walked through the portal. She walked out into a familiar scene. Red, dusty rock stood under her feet. The sky was littered with creatures gliding past. She smiled at the scene and turn to wait for the others to come through. "Are you sure we should go in there?" Videl asked.
"Do you want the Earth to be destroyed?" Vegeta replied.
Videl looked down and her spirit sank to the ground. Goku placed his hand on her shoulder. She looked up at him about to burst into tears. Goku smiled gently at her.
"We'll save him Videl. Don't worry." Goku reassured her.
A small smile formed on Videl's face. Vegeta rolled his eyes and walked through the portal. Piccolo waited for Goku to guide Videl through and he followed after them. A small creature walked up to Karukono. It was short, coming only to Karukono's shoulder. It was equipped with light blue skin, large brown eyes behind a pair of thick rimmed glasses, and messy black hair with small horns on either side. The creature was holding a notebook and a pen. It adjusted its glasses and sighed.
"Karukono the King will not be pleased with you." The creature stated in the expected nerd sounding way.
Karukono stuck up her nose. "Since when do I care what he says" She replied.
"There is a reason you are not meant to see her. The fact that you disobeyed the King is an underscore of what could have happened if you had made any contact with her."
"Garish...Leave me alone." Karukono remarked as she started to turn away.
Garish eyes narrowed but flung open when he saw Karukono's guest standing beside her.
"You brought HUMANS into our world!!" Garish cried.
Passing demons stopped and stared. Karukono whipped around and covered Garish's mouth with her hand. She leaned in to whisper to him.
"Quiet! Do you want to get me killed?!" She said quietly.
Garish looked around at the demons staring at him.
"Heh. Um...false alarm folks they are for testing at the science wing...um...move along now..." Garish lied.
The demons hesitated but eventually flew off. Videl walked a few steps forward as she marveled at the site she was seeing. The sky was a crimson red with black spilt over it...like a bomb had gone off...The ground was a dull red rock that stretched for miles. A vast variety of creatures passed by, they were all different colors, different shapes.
"Oh dear!" Garish cried. Videl looked at him only to find him looking at her.
"Karukono please tell me you didn't do what I think you did..." Garish started. "Please Karukono you-
"Look, it's ok. I didn't tell anyone so we are all safe." Karukono explained.
"But she...she is..."
"Yes Garish she is. But that doesn't matter."
Garish looked to the ground.
"I'm going to leave you now...but Karukono if it happens because you let her here I swear..." Garish threatened. He faded and was gone.
Everyone's eyes were one Videl.
"Karukono...What was he talking about? What about me?" Videl asked.
"It's...nothing..." Karukono sighed. "Let's continue, shall we?"
Karukono rose into the air.
"It will be much faster to go to the club first. But I don't know if you'll be able to copse anyone to go along with your plan." Karukono stated as she hovered in the air.
"It's a long shot, but it's the only option left." Goku replied.
"Very well..."
Karukono sped off and the others followed.
Gohan awoke to a dark sky. His head still throbbed and his eyes remained black. The thought of all he had done lingered in his mind. Slowly, he got up and roamed about the remains of the once grand city. Body after body encased the street in blood. Gohan wandered into a small house. The windows were shattered, a man and a woman lay slumped over on the ground. A soft whining noise echoed in the dark house. Gohan followed it to a bedroom. Everything was turned over and the light above flickered. In the corner a small girl cried...huddle in a tight ball. Gohan bit his lip. He walked over to the girl and sat down beside her. The girl looked up and sniffled.
"Are you going to kill me now to?" The girl asked weakly.
Gohan's eyes grew with sadness and fear.
"No. I'm not going to hurt you."
"But why? You killed Mommy and Daddy."
Gohan hesitated. How do you respond to something like that?
"I-
Gohan was cut short when a familiar urge panged in his head.
"No...not again. You've had your fill...Now leave me alone..." Gohan pleaded.
"You want this power. Don't try to fight it."
Gohan stood up and stumbled backwards.
"No. I'm not a killer. I'm not a killer!"
"Oh but you are. You are...You enjoyed slaughtering those people. You enjoyed killing your mother..."
"Stop it! Shut up and leave me alone! I didn't do those things you did!"
"Don't you see? I AM you. You are me. We are one and the same."
"No. We are not."
"Tsk. Tsk. trying to avoid it are you? Well that just won't do...Now just go to sleep or things will get rough."
"Go away. GO AWAY!"
The girl in the corner started to cry loudly. Gohan whipped around and grabbed the girl's shoulders.
"Don't you cry kid! Don't you cry!" Gohan ordered as her shook her violently.
The girl cried harder and struggled to free herself from his grip.
"You see? You are killers...go to sleep...let me take over..."
Gohan released the girl and sank to the ground. He fell over on his side and everything whirled around him. Gohan tried to focus...to stay awake...but the pang was getting stronger...His eyes grew faint and closed.
